About Prospect Capital Corporation

Prospect Capital Corp is a closed-end investment company based in the United States. Its investment objective is to generate both current income and long-term capital appreciation through debt and equity investments. The company invests primarily in senior and subordinated debt and equity of private companies for acquisitions, divestitures, growth, development, recapitalizations, and other purposes. It makes investments, including lending in private equity, sponsored transactions, directly to companies, investments in structured credit, real estate, and syndicated debt.

About Xpeng Inc - ADR

Founded in 2015, XPeng is a leading Chinese smart electric vehicle, or EV, company that designs, develops, manufactures and markets EVs in China. Its products primarily target the growing base of technology-savvy middle-class consumers in the midrange to high-end segment in China's passenger vehicle market. The company sold over 98,000 EVs in 2021, accounting for about 3% of China's passenger new energy vehicle market. It is also a leader in autonomous driving technology.
